This job is for an operations assistant at a bowling center on a U.S. Army base in Hawaii, where you'll help run daily activities like handling cash, serving customers, and setting up events.
It's a good fit for someone with experience in customer-facing roles, basic financial tasks, and a reliable, detail-oriented personality who enjoys working in a recreational setting.
No advanced education is needed, but you must be at least 21 if alcohol service is involved.
This position is located at MWR Schofield Bowling Center, Schofield Barracks, Hawaii (Island of Oahu). Incentives and Bonuses Incentives will not be paid.
To better expedite the hiring process, we recommend including full contact information (name, address, phone number, email, etc.) for professional and personal references on your resume.
Resumes must be two pages (or less). Resumes should clearly demonstrate the applicant's relevant experience, skills, knowledge and abilities as they pertain to this position.
A qualified candidate must possess the following: Minimum Qualifications: Progressively responsible duties in the receipt, disbursement, examination, deposit, custody or other processing of cash items.
Where duties involve selling alcoholic beverages applicant must meet state/local age requirements (21 years of age) for the serving of alcoholic beverage at the time of appointment.
Skill in providing customer service. Ability to communicate effectively. *Resume MUST clearly reflect the knowledge and experience listed under the minimum qualifications criteria above.*.
